jfinal是一个基于Java的开源MVC框架,用于构建Web应用程序。它提供了简单易用的API和强大的功能,可以帮助开发人员快速开发可靠的、高效的应用程序。
连接MySQL数据库是在jfinal中使用数据库的常见需求之一。下面是完善且全面的答案:
- 概念:MySQL是一种开源的关系型数据库管理系统,它支持跨平台,并且非常流行。它提供了可靠的数据存储和高效的数据检索,被广泛用于各种Web应用程序和企业级解决方案。
- 分类:MySQL属于关系型数据库管理系统(RDBMS),使用SQL(Structured Query Language)进行数据管理和查询。它是一种客户端/服务器模型的数据库,支持多用户同时访问。
- 优势:
- 可靠性和稳定性:MySQL在实际应用中经过了广泛测试和验证,具有良好的稳定性和可靠性。
- 高性能:MySQL具有出色的性能特征,能够处理大量的并发请求和复杂的查询。
- 可扩展性:MySQL支持水平和垂直的扩展,可以通过添加更多的服务器和调整硬件来满足应用程序的需求。
- 安全性:MySQL提供了多层次的安全性措施,包括用户权限管理、数据加密、安全传输等。
- 应用场景:MySQL适用于各种规模的应用程序和场景,包括但不限于:
- Web应用程序:包括电子商务、社交媒体、博客、论坛等各种网站。
- 企业级解决方案:如CRM系统、ERP系统、人力资源管理系统等。
- 大数据分析:MySQL可以与其他大数据处理工具(如Hadoop)结合使用,进行复杂的数据分析和挖掘。
- 推荐的腾讯云相关产品:腾讯云提供了多种与MySQL相关的产品和服务,如下所示:
- 云数据库MySQL:提供高可用性、高性能、弹性扩展的MySQL数据库服务,支持一键备份、灾备容灾等功能。产品链接:云数据库MySQL
总结:jfinal连接MySQL数据库是一种常见的开发需求,通过使用MySQL作为后端数据库,可以实现可靠的数据存储和高效的数据检索。腾讯云的云数据库MySQL是一款可靠且易用的云服务,推荐作为jfinal应用程序的数据库选择。